Simla, June 8: A feeble advance of the Arabian sea monsoon has given general rain in Malabar and Bombay Deccan. Bay monsoon is strengthening. The western disturbance has passed away. Rainfall has been nearly general in Lower Burma, Malabar, Bombay Deccan, Local in Assam, North Hyderabad while a few falls occurred in Upper Burma, Bengal, Bihar, East Rajaputana, East Central Provinces, South Hyderabad and South East Madras. Chief amounts are: — Mergui, Rangoon 3-4, Tavoy, Kyaukpyu 1, Maymo 1 and a half, Berhampore, Mymensingh 3-4, Udaipur 1-2, Jagdalpur 3, Cochin 2, Poona, Sholapur, Cuddalore, 1-2 Kodaikanal 1 inch.Temperature is appreciably above normal in central parts of the country and North East of the Peninsula.Forecast of monsoon rainfall for 1926: — Monsoon rainfall is likely to be normal in the Peninsula and in north-east India but in some defect in north west India.
